Output f5fccb81a15a0231975583d33e22e2f368d25099a4b59c6b375e5d8dfd78e32a:4

value
18125213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c6e008ef483ab61446477a83acad17cb35c31c OP_EQUAL
address
MDiP3bt8pZGkw8yeAsUyKKnZQiPq4bDp46
transaction
f5fccb81a15a0231975583d33e22e2f368d25099a4b59c6b375e5d8dfd78e32a
spent
true